Government of India

Ministry of Finance

Department of Revenue

Central Board of Excise & Customs

New Delhi, the 13TH Jan, 2000

NOTIFICATION

No. 3/2000-Central Excise (N.T.), dated 13-1-2000.

Inter-warehousing movement – Notification No 266/67- CE(NT) amended

In pursuance of sub-rule (2) of rule 49 and rule 139 of the Central Excise Rules, 1944, the Central Government hereby makes the following further amendment in the notification of the Government of India in the Ministry of Finance (Department of Revenue and Insurance) No. 266/67-Central Excise, dated 28th November, 1967 namely:-

In paragraph of 2 of the said notification, in clause (i), after sub-clause (zzzm) sub-clauses shall be inserted, namely:-

“(zzzn) Baitalpur, District – Deora (U.P.)

(zzzo Banthra, District – Shahijanpur (U.P.).”
